Jobs

Customer Support Specialist Jobs in 29464

(1 - 1 of 1)
  1. We are seeking outgoing individuals for our Customer Support positions. You will work from home booking vacations for leisure and corporate clients around the world. This is perfect for anyone who loves to travel and loves to help others with pla...
    Over 4 weeks ago on The Resumator

SET LOCATION

zip
country